Interior Concrete Waterproofing: Protect Your Concrete Against Water Damage

Monday, October 27th, 2008

Moisture is a major enemy of concrete. It can weaken concrete, make it crack and in general cause deterioration of any concrete structure. Moisture can also cause staining and fungus that is nearly impossible to remove. Interior concrete waterproofing can help prevent moisture damage of this type.

Things to Know When Waterproofing Basements

Thursday, August 28th, 2008

Waterproofing basements is largely a structural matter. Whether you are building a new home or fixing up an old one the most important thing is the location of home in relationship to any soil that could hold a large amount of water and cause hydrostatic build up against the walls of your home.
